Test your knowledge with free interactive questions on Seneca — used by over 10 million students.

Flat-File Databases

Flat-file databases are used to store records of information in order to be searched or queried at a later date.

Structure of flat-file databases

Structure of flat-file databases

  • A flat-file database is one that has a single table to store data about an 'entity'.
  • The table stores data in fields (columns) such as date of birth.
  • A record (row) of information is a complete set of fields put together.
    • This could be a person's details such as name, address, date of birth, telephone number.
Redundancy

Redundancy

  • Redundant data is data that is repeated in a database.
  • A single table file is inefficient as it is full of redundant data
Primary key

Primary key

  • A primary key is a field used to uniquely identify a specific row of data in a table.
  • For example, each student in a college database will have a student ID number that is unique to each student that can be used as a primary key
Jump to other topics
1

Components of a Computer

2

Software & Software Development

3

Exchanging Data

4

Data Types, Data Structures & Algorithms

5

Legal, Moral, Cultural & Ethical Issues

6

Elements of Computational Thinking

6.1

Thinking Abstractly

6.2

Thinking Ahead

6.3

Thinking Procedurally

6.4

Thinking Logically

6.5

Thinking Concurrently

7

Problem Solving & Programming

8

Algorithms

Practice questions on Databases

Can you answer these? Test yourself with free interactive practice on Seneca — used by over 10 million students.

  1. 1
  2. 2
Answer all questions on Databases

Unlock your full potential with Seneca Premium

  • Unlimited access to 10,000+ open-ended exam questions

  • Mini-mock exams based on your study history

  • Unlock 800+ premium courses & e-books

Get started with Seneca Premium